Pedestal Wash Basins
What Is a Pedestal Wash Basin?
A pedestal basin consists of a sink supported by a vertical pedestal. The pedestal hides plumbing lines while also supporting the basin’s weight.
This style has remained popular for decades because of its clean appearance and timeless design appeal.
Many homeowners still prefer pedestal basins because they provide a balanced mix of elegance, simplicity, and affordability.
Advantages of Pedestal Wash Basins
Timeless and Elegant Design
Pedestal basins offer a classic appearance that works well in both traditional and contemporary bathrooms. Their smooth vertical structure creates a clean and balanced visual effect.
Concealed Plumbing Connections
One of the biggest benefits is the ability to hide plumbing pipes within the pedestal structure, making the bathroom look cleaner and more organised.
Cost-Effective Bathroom Solution
Pedestal basins are often more affordable compared to premium vanity-based options, making them suitable for many residential projects.
Easy Installation Process
Compared to some modern basin designs, pedestal basins are relatively simple to install.
Suitable for Medium-Sized Bathrooms
Pedestal basins fit well in medium-sized bathrooms, offering a balance between style and practicality.

Counter Wash Basins
What Is a Counter Wash Basin?
Counter basins are installed above a vanity or countertop surface. These basins are widely used in luxury bathrooms because they create a highly premium and designer appearance.

Wall-Hung Wash Basins
What Is a Wall-Hung Wash Basin?
A wall-hung basin is mounted directly onto the wall without any pedestal or floor support.
This floating appearance creates a sleek, modern, and space-saving design.
Wall-mounted basins have become increasingly popular in compact urban homes and minimalist interiors.
Advantages of Wall-Hung Wash Basins
Space-Saving Design
One of the biggest advantages of wall-hung basins is their ability to maximise floor space.
Compact bathrooms feel more spacious because the area underneath remains open.
Minimalist Modern Appearance
Wall-hung basins create a clean and uncluttered look that perfectly complements modern interiors.
Easier Cleaning
Cleaning becomes simpler because the floor beneath the basin remains accessible.
Ideal for Compact Bathrooms
Urban apartments and smaller bathrooms benefit significantly from wall-hung installations.
Flexible Height Installation
These basins can be mounted at customised heights depending on user comfort.
Limitations of Wall-Hung Wash Basins
Wall-mounted basins also come with certain considerations.
- Limited storage options
- Requires strong wall support
- Plumbing concealment may increase installation complexity.
- Less countertop utility

Pedestal vs Counter vs Wall-Hung Wash Basins
Space Efficiency Comparison
When it comes to maximising bathroom space, wall-hung basins are the most effective.
Counter basins require more room due to vanity integration, while pedestal basins occupy moderate floor space.
Visual Appearance Comparison
Counter basins create the most luxurious appearance.
Wall-hung basins provide a modern, minimalist look, while pedestal basins maintain timeless elegance.
Storage Comparison
Counter basins offer the highest storage capacity because they integrate with vanity cabinets.
Pedestal and wall-hung basins provide minimal storage.
Cleaning and Maintenance Comparison
Wall-hung basins are easiest to clean underneath.
Counter basins require additional countertop cleaning, while pedestal basins need moderate maintenance.
Installation Complexity Comparison
Pedestal basins are relatively easier to install.
Counter basins require vanity integration and countertop preparation.
Wall-hung basins require strong wall support and concealed plumbing planning.
